This Remote Start/Keyless Entry System is designed for use with Automatic Transmission Vehicles Only! The unit provides wait to start input for glow plug pre-heat which will be used for all diesel applications. If this wire is not connected, then the unit will remain in the Gasoline mode setting, which will crank the car when the RF signal is received with no delay. THE RECEIVER/ANTENNA ASSEMBLY: The Superheterodyne Receiver Antenna Assembly provided with this unit allows routing from below the dashboard for maximum operating range. Choose a location above the belt line (dashboard) of the vehicle for best reception. Special considerations must be made for windshield glass as some newer vehicles utilize a metallic shielded window glass that will inhibit or restrict RF reception. VIOLET WIRE: Accessory Output Connect this wire to the Accessory wire from the ignition switch. This wire will show + 12 volts when the ignition switch is turned to the "ACCESSORY" or "ON" and "RUN" positions and will show 0 volts when the key is turned to the "OFF" and "START" or "CRANK" positions. The Red & Green Door Lock/Unlock output wires provide either a pulsed ground or pulsed + 12 volts to control the vehicle door lock / unlock circuits. The output of these wires has a maximum switching capability of 300mA. Many vehicles today have factory door lock relays which can be connected directly to these outputs, however always confirm that the factory relays in your particular vehicle do not exceed the rated 300mA output of the units door lock/unlock circuit.
